Olympian Motors is an electric vehicle manufacturer based in New York, known for its art-deco styled vehicles and innovative modular architecture. The company focuses on aesthetics, simplicity, and timeless design principles, setting itself apart from traditional automotive design. Olympian operates on a direct-to-consumer model, allowing customers to pre-order vehicles online. The company’s proprietary Modular Vehicle & Drivetrain System (eMVDS) offers significant advantages, including an 80% reduction in tooling costs and 60% faster production lead times compared to legacy automakers. Olympian Motors has a diverse product line featuring four main models, including the Model O1 and Model 84, both priced at $80K, and the Model 42 MPV, priced at $60K. The company has received over 840 orders and has a revenue backlog exceeding $62 million, with plans to produce 2,400 units by 2026. Olympian aims to capture a 7% market share of the U.S. automotive market by 2030, focusing on major metropolitan areas.
